IoT Mikro Yazılım Güncellemelerini Otomatikleştirme: Adım Adım Rehber

IoT Mikro Yazılım Güncellemelerini Otomatikleştirme: Adım Adım Rehber

IoT mikro yazılım güncellemelerini otomatikleştirme, ev ağınızdaki akıllı cihazların güvenli ve sorunsuz çalışmasını sağlayan kritik bir adımdır. Manuel güncellemelerin yetersiz kaldığı güncel ev ortamlarında, otomatik süreçler hata riskini azaltır ve güvenlik açıklarını minimize eder. Bu rehber, adım adım uygulanabilir stratejiler ve gerçek dünya uygulamalarıyla konuyu ele alıyor.

İçindekiler

Ev Ağı IoT Cihazlarında Mikro Yazılım Güncellemelerini Otomatikleştirme: Neden Önemlidir

Peki ya kis aylarında çıkan güvenlik açığı güncellemelerini manuel olarak takip etmek ne kadar pratik? Kesin olmamakla birlikte, ev ağı içindeki birbirinden farklı cihazlar için otomatik güncellemeler, güvenlik olaylarını ve uyum sorunlarını azaltır. Otomatik süreçler, cihazların en son protokollerle çalışmasını sağlar; ayrıca sürüm çatışmaları ve yapılandırma karışıklıklarını da minimize eder. Deneyimlerimize göre, otomatik güncellemeler sayesinde ev otomasyonunda kesinti süreleri önemli ölçüde düşer ve kullanıcı memnuniyeti artar.

Otomatik Güncelleme Stratejileri ve Sürüm Yönetimi

Etkin bir güncelleme stratejisi, yalnızca “güncelleme yap” demekten daha fazlasını gerektirir. Aşağıdaki pratik yönlendirmeler, sürüm yönetimini güvenli ve verimli kılar:

  • Envanter yönetimi: Cihaz tipleri ve desteklenen sürümler için güncel bir envanter oluşturun. Cihaz adeti arttıkça güncelleme planı daha da kritik hale gelir.
  • Staging ve prodüksiyon: İlk olarak birkaç güvenilir cihazda test edin; sorunlar tespit edilirse geri dönüşümlü adımlar uygulanır.
  • A/B testleri: Farklı sürümlerin performansını karşılaştırarak hangi sürümün daha stabil çalıştığını belirleyin.
  • Zamanlanmış güncellemeler: Yoğun kullanım saatlerinde güncelleme yerine, gece yarısı gibi düşük trafik zamanlarını tercih edin.
Ev içi IoT cihazlarının yazılım güncelleme sürecini gösteren tablo
Ev içi IoT cihazlarının yazılım güncelleme sürecini gösteren tablo

Güvenlik ve Uyumluluk: Mikro Yazılım Güncellemelerini Güçlendirmek

Güvenlik, mikro yazılım güncellemelerinin kalbinde yer alır. İmza doğrulama, TLS ile iletim güvenliği ve cihaz kimliği doğrulaması en temel unsurlardır. Ayrıca sertifika güncelleme politikaları ile güvenilir bir kaynaktan gelen paketler yüklenir. Uyumluluk ise sürüm bağımlılıklarını karşılıyor olmakla ilgilidir; eski cihazlar için uyumlu sürümler belirlenir ve kontratlı güncelleme takvimleri oluşturulur.

OTA Tabanlı Güncelleme Süreçleri ve Rollback Stratejileri

Over-The-Air (OTA) güncellemeler, ev ağında en yaygın kullanılan otomasyon yöntemlerinden biridir. Kesinti risklerini azaltmak için rollback planı vazgeçilmezdir. Önerilen adımlar:

  • Güncelleme paketleri için imza doğrulaması ve bütünlük kontrolü.
  • Güç kaynağı bağımlılıklarının karşılandığından emin olun (batarya/şebeke enerjisi).
  • Güncelleme başarısız olduğunda eski sürüme güvenli geri dönme mekanizması.
  • Kullanıcıya net bildirimler ve tersine uyum sağlama seçenekleri sunun.

Gerçek Dünya Uygulamaları: Ev Ağı Örnek Senaryoları

Sabah işe giderken akıllı ampuller ve termostatlar için küçük bir güncelleme paketi dağıtmak, ev güvenliğini ve konforu artırabilir. Örneğin, güvenlik kameraları için en son iyileştirmeyi içeren OTA yüklemesi, kimlik doğrulama akışını güçlendirebilir. Diğer bir senaryo ise ev asistanı ve sensörler arasındaki sürüm uyuşmazlığına karşılık staging ortamında test edilmesiyle sorunsuz bir güncelleme akışı sağlamaktır. Bu tür uygulamalar, kullanıcı deneyimini doğrudan etkiler.

Riskler ve En İyi Uygulama Önerileri

  • Riskler: Bricking riski, uyumsuz cihazlar ve enerji kesintisi durumlarında güncellemenin yarıda kalması.
  • Öneriler: Güncelleme envanteri; rollback planı; güvenli iletim ve dijital imza doğrulaması; kritik cihazlar için ekstra test adımı.
  • İpuçları: Belirli cihazlar için düşük riskli sürümleri öncelemeli, kullanıcıya bildirimle ilerlemeli ve acil durumlarda geri dönüş imkânı sunmalısınız.

Sonuç ve Başlangıç

Ev ağı için mikro yazılım güncellemelerini otomatikleştirmek, güvenlik ve kullanılabilirlik açısından en akıllıca yoldur. İlk adım olarak envanter çıkartın, staging ortamı kurun ve rollback planını yazılı olarak belirleyin. Ardından OTA üzerinden kademeli güncellemelerle ilerleyin ve kullanıcılar için açık iletişim kanalları oluşturun. Şimdi bu konudaki düşüncelerinizi paylaşın: hangi cihazlarda başlamayı planlıyorsunuz, yorumlarda belirtin ve birlikte en güvenli yaklaşımı kuralım.

Related Posts

Bir yanıt yazın

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ir

Yükleniyor...